What is Acupuncture?
As one of the oldest forms of medicine in the world, acupuncture is a key component of traditional Eastern medicine. It is known to be an alternative, holistic technique that uses the human body and certain points to help reset your energy or stimulate an area where you desire healing. At Chicago Rehab Center, we view acupuncture as a useful tool for rejuvenating your nervous system during recovery.
Acupuncture uses very thin needles at specific points in your body in order to provide healing benefits and improve overall wellness. This process is known to cause very little or no discomfort, but instead stimulates areas in the body that need a reset, whether the symptoms you are experiencing relate to the body or the mind. The Process: Acupuncture Treatments in Arlington Heights
If you decide that acupuncture treatment is right for you, you will meet with a certified acupuncturist who will use sterilized, hair-thin needles at various points in your body to achieve the health goals that have previously been established. Before each treatment, you will discuss with the acupuncturist your goal for treatment and what you are hoping to achieve by participating in acupuncture.
The acupuncture treatment itself may only take a few minutes, but after the needles are inserted, you will rest and allow the benefits of the treatment to travel throughout your body. Your professional acupuncturist will determine the number of treatments that are best for you and are always available to answer any questions as they arise.
What are the Risks of Acupuncture?
The risks of acupuncture are minimal. While risks remain incredibly low, we recommend the following individuals consult a healthcare professional before participating in treatment.
- Have a pacemaker — acupuncture treatments that involve mild electrical pulses can potentially interfere with your pacemaker’s operation.
- Have chronic skin problems — you may be at a greater risk for infection
- Have a bleeding disorder — If you take blood thinners, have a bleeding disorder, your risk for bruising and bleeding may increase.
- Are pregnant — some forms of acupuncture are thought to stimulate labor.

Will my acupuncture treatment be painful?
Many people are needle adverse and may feel hesitant about acupuncture in Arlington Heights. However, the needles used in acupuncture are very different from needles that are used to draw blood or receive a vaccine.
Acupuncture needles are tiny and hair string-like that are disposable and are not known to cause pain. Some describe a tingly feeling or a warm feeling, and for many, the feeling provides a feeling of peace and wellbeing. If you are uncomfortable or experiencing pain, do not hesitate to let your acupuncturist know and they will help you navigate the process with ease.
